#df1969 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df1969 is composed of 87.5% red, 9.8%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.8% magenta, 52.9%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 335.8 degrees, a saturation of 79.8% and a lightness of 48.6%. #df1969 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ff32d2 with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#df1969 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df1969 has RGB values of R:223, G:25,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.53,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14621033.

Shades and Tints of #df1969
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0105 is the darkest color, while #fef9fb is the lightest one.
